OVRx Logo

OVRx

Locations: San Antonio, TX 78259, US

Company Size: 1 - 100

Industry: Media Production

Company Website

AI Description

drawer
  • Dan Crossland profile image

    Director of Virtualization Technology at OVRx

  • MARK "The Shark" MOORE profile image

    My mission is to help people rekindle adventure and experience bucket list moments!